Qualcomm, a global leader in wireless technology and semiconductor innovation, hosted its first-ever “Snapdragon for India Auto Day 2025” in New Delhi. The event marked a significant milestone in India’s automotive transformation, spotlighting Qualcomm’s comprehensive Snapdragon Digital Chassis platform, which includes connected-car technologies, advanced driver-assistance systems (ADAS), infotainment systems, and cloud-based vehicle services.
Backed by collaborations with leading Indian auto manufacturers like Maruti Suzuki, Mahindra, Hero MotoCorp, and Ultraviolette, Qualcomm demonstrated how its platforms are reshaping the future of mobility in India through immersive, safe, and intelligent vehicle experiences.

Snapdragon Digital Chassis: A Unified Platform for Connected Mobility
At the heart of Qualcomm’s automotive vision is the Snapdragon Digital Chassis, a suite of modular and scalable cloud-connected platforms developed to support:
- Digital Cockpit experiences
- Driver assistance (ADAS)
- Vehicle-to-Cloud connectivity
- Autonomous driving
- Infotainment and navigation
- In-vehicle personalization and safety monitoring
This platform includes the following components:
1. Snapdragon Cockpit
Delivers high-resolution infotainment, driver interaction, digital displays, voice assistant features, and entertainment, transforming vehicles into smart, personalized spaces.
2. Snapdragon Ride
Handles critical safety and driver assistance tasks including ADAS, object detection, autonomous driving, lane-keeping, emergency braking, and more.
3. Snapdragon Ride Flex
A multi-role SoC that merges compute workloads for cockpit, ADAS, and autonomous systems into one efficient chip, reducing latency and increasing energy efficiency.
4. Snapdragon Auto Connectivity
Provides 4G/5G, Wi-Fi, GPS, and Bluetooth support for seamless connectivity between the vehicle and cloud, enabling features like OTA (over-the-air) updates and live diagnostics.
5. Snapdragon Car-to-Cloud
Supports continuous vehicle software upgrades, subscription-based services, and personalized user profiles accessible from any connected car.

Two-Wheeler Technology: Snapdragon Ride for Motorcycles
India being the world’s largest two-wheeler market, Qualcomm also introduced Snapdragon Ride for two-wheelers, aiming to enhance safety, convenience, and digital experiences for bikers.
Key Features:
- 4G/5G, GPS, and Bluetooth connectivity
- Rider alerts for charging stations and service notifications
- Roadside assistance and theft prevention
- Integration with helmets and smart dashboards
These innovations are ideal for brands like Hero MotoCorp and Ultraviolette, which are actively developing connected and electric two-wheelers.
Industry Collaborations: Transforming Indian Automotive Brands
1. Maruti Suzuki India Ltd. (MSIL)
- Qualcomm chips have been powering Maruti cars since 2022, starting with the Baleno.
- Future models like the e-Vitara will run Qualcomm’s digital cockpit and telematics platforms.
2. Mahindra & Mahindra
- Models like the Mahindra BE 6 and XEV 9e integrate:
- Qualcomm’s sensing software
- Audio processing systems
- RAiDiO.FYI by artist will.i.am for personalized music
- Melodic Drive for mood-based audio enhancement
3. Ultraviolette
- Focused on electric motorcycles, Ultraviolette is collaborating with Qualcomm to embed real-time navigation, connectivity, and safety alerts into its vehicle ecosystem.
4. Hero MotoCorp and Royal Enfield
- Working with Qualcomm to roll out connected features in upcoming motorcycle lineups, focusing on urban mobility, route prediction, and rider safety.
Qualcomm Flex SoC: Powering Everything in One Chip
A major highlight at the event was the unveiling of the Qualcomm Flex SoC, a multi-functional commercial system-on-chip that brings several vehicle systems into a unified processing environment.
Capabilities of Flex SoC:
- Infotainment control
- Driver monitoring and alertness detection
- Computer vision-based navigation
- High-definition maps and route processing
- Cybersecurity protection
- In-cabin personalization
This powerful chip reduces the need for multiple ECUs (electronic control units), thereby lowering cost and improving vehicle performance and integration.
Demonstrations and Real-World Impact
Over 120 real-world automotive demonstrations were held at the event, showcasing how Snapdragon technology is not just theoretical but production-ready.
Demos Included:
- Multi-screen cockpit experiences
- Live ADAS performance simulations
- Cloud-based diagnostics and remote vehicle configuration
- AI-driven driver assistance scenarios
- AR and VR displays for in-vehicle infotainment
